TREEBEARD TRUST's Investments

ODDBOX DELIVERY LTD09638976Studio 3.09 / 3.10 New Covent Garden Market, The Food Exchange, London, England, SW8 5EL

© Shade U.K. Ltd. All rights reserved.

Shade U.K. Ltd (Company Number: 15880668) is a fintech company and not a bank. The company is currently in the pre-launch phase and is not offering any financial services at this time. Upon launch, services will be available exclusively to companies registered in the United Kingdom. Shade Flex, a B2B lending product, is not subject to financial regulation. Money Market Funds are classified as investment products and are subject to variable rates. Shade U.K. Ltd is a wholly owned subsidiary of Shade Group Inc.